Tree Risk Management

In addition to our extensive experience inspecting trees, we are Lantra Professional Tree Inspection certificated and registered users of the Quantified Tree Risk Assessment (QTRA) approach. We undertake risk assessments for all scales of site.

Protected Trees & Tree Law

Where trees are protected by a Conservation Area, are subject to a Tree Preservation Order (TPO) or there are Felling Licence requirements, we can negotiate and specify works to trees, make applications or notifications.
